Triadimefon; Notice of Receipt of Requests to Voluntarily Cancel
or to Amend to Terminate Uses of Triadimefon Pesticide Registrations
AGENCY: Environmental Protection Agency (EPA).
ACTION: Notice.
-----------------------------------------------------------------------
SUMMARY: In accordance with section 6(f)(1) of the Federal
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odenticide Act (FIFRA), as amended, EPA is
issuing a notice of receipt of requests by registrants to voluntarily
cancel and amend their registrations to terminate uses of certain
products containing the pesticide triadimefon. The requests would
terminate triadimefon use in or on apples, pears, grapes, raspberries,
and residential turf. The requests would not terminate the last
triadimefon product registered for use in the United States. EPA
intends to grant these requests at the close of the comment period for
this announcement unless the Agency receives substantive comments
within the comment period that would merit its further review of the
requests, or unless the registrants withdraw their requests within this
period. Upon acceptance of this request, any sale, distribution, or use
of products listed in this notice will be permitted only if such sale,
distribution, or use is consistent with the terms as described in the
final order.

II. Background on the Receipt of Requests to Amend Registrations to
Delete Uses
This notice announces receipt by EPA of requests from the
registrants Bayer CropScience, Bayer Environmental Science, and Bayer
Advanced to cancel and amend to terminate uses of the triadimefon
products listed in Tables 1 and 2. Triadimefon is a broad spectrum
fungicide used for the systemic control of rust and mildew on various
fruits and pineapple. In addition, it is used to control various fungal
diseases on non-food use sites such as golf course and sod farm turf,
pine seedlings, Christmas trees, and ornamentals. In a letter dated
July 31, 2006, Bayer CropScience, Bayer Environmental Science, and
Bayer Advanced requested EPA to voluntarily cancel and amend their
registrations to terminate use(s) of certain products containing the
pesticide triadimefon identified in this notice Tables 1 and 2.
Specifically, the registrant has agreed to voluntarily cancel all use
on apples, pears, grapes, and raspberries (commercial and residential)
as well as use on residential turf. The registrant's request for these
use deletions will not terminate the last triadimefon products
registered in the United States, or the last pesticide products
registered in the United States for these uses.
III. What Action is the Agency Taking?
This notice announces receipt by EPA of requests from registrants
to cancel and/or amend to terminate uses of triadimefon product
registrations. The affected products and the registrants making the
requests are identified in Tables 1 - 3 of this unit.
Under section 6(f)(1)(A) of FIFRA, registrants may request, at any
time, that their pesticide registrations be canceled or amended to
terminate one or more pesticide uses. Section 6(f)(1)(B) of FIFRA
requires that before acting on a request for voluntary cancellation,
EPA must provide a 30-day public comment period on the request for
voluntary cancellation or use termination. In addition, section
6(f)(1)(C) of FIFRA requires that EPA provide a 180-day comment period
on a request for voluntary cancellation or termination of any minor
agricultural use before granting the request, unless:
1. The registrants request a waiver of the comment period, or
2. The Administrator determines that continued use of the pesticide
would pose an unreasonable adverse effect on the environment.
The triadimefon registrants have declined to waive the 180-day
comment period. EPA will provide a 180-day comment period on the
proposed requests.
Unless a request is withdrawn by the registrant within 180 days of
publication of this notice, or if the Agency determines that there are
substantive comments that warrant further review of this request, an
order will be issued canceling or amending the affected registrations.

IV. What is the Agency's Authority for Taking this Action?
Section 6(f)(1) of FIFRA provides that a registrant of a pesticide
product may at any time request that any of its pesticide registrations
be canceled or amended to terminate one or more uses. FIFRA further
provides that, before acting on the request, EPA must publish a notice
of receipt of any such request in the Federal Register. Thereafter,
following the public comment period, the Administrator may approve such
a request.
V. Procedures for Withdrawal of Request and Considerations for
Reregistration of Triadimefon
Registrants who choose to withdraw a request for cancellation must
submit such withdrawal in writing to the person listed under FOR
F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T, postmarked before May 7, 2007. This
written withdrawal of the request for cancellation will apply only to
the applicable FIFRA section 6(f)(1) request listed in this notice. If
the products have been subject to a previous cancellation action, the
effective date of cancellation and all other provisions of any earlier
cancellation action are controlling.
VI. Provisions for Disposition of Existing Stocks
Existing stocks are those stocks of registered pesticide products
which are currently in the United States and which were packaged,
labeled, and released for shipment prior to the effective date of the
cancellation action.
If the request for voluntary cancellation and use termination is
granted as discussed above, the Agency intends to issue a cancellation
order that will allow persons other than the registrant to continue to
sell and/or use existing stocks of cancelled products until such stocks
are exhausted, provided that such use is consistent with the terms of
the previously approved labeling on, or that accompanied, the cancelled
product. The order will specifically prohibit any use of existing
stocks that is not consistent with such previously approved labeling.
If, as the Agency currently intends, the final cancellation
[[Page 65496]]
order contains the existing stocks provision just described, the order
will be sent only to the affected registrants of the cancelled
products. If the Agency determines that the final cancellation order
should contain existing stocks provisions different than the ones just
described, the Agency will publish the cancellation order in the
Federal Register.
